Color Scheme

A successful color scheme in country decor blends earthy tones and muted pastels to create a warm, inviting atmosphere that complements various patterns. To achieve this, start with a dominant color that ties all elements together, guaranteeing that patterns in a room harmonize rather than clash.

Incorporating neutrals like whites, creams, or soft grays can help balance more vibrant colors, making the space feel cohesive and comfortable without overwhelming the senses.

Consider the changing seasons when selecting your color palette. For instance, warm oranges and deep reds in the fall can evoke coziness, while soft greens and blues in the spring can bring a rejuvenating lightness. This adaptability keeps your decor feeling dynamic and relevant throughout the year.

Materials

Natural materials like cotton, linen, and wool create a cozy atmosphere that enhances the rustic charm of country decor. When you're mixing patterns, these fabrics not only provide comfort but also serve as a perfect backdrop for your design.

Incorporate textured materials like burlap and chambray to add depth and interest while keeping that inviting country feel.

Using vintage or reclaimed materials, such as antique quilts or repurposed upholstery, can greatly enrich your space's character and history. These pieces often feature unique patterns that blend seamlessly with traditional country styles like gingham, floral prints, and plaids.

This approach helps you create a cohesive atmosphere that feels both familiar and stylish.

Vintage Farmhouse Dining Table

A vintage farmhouse dining table brings warmth and character to your home, combining reclaimed wood with unique grain patterns that tell a story of sustainability and rustic charm. These tables often come in various styles, like trestle, pedestal, or drop-leaf, providing flexibility to fit any dining space or accommodate different guest numbers. Ranging from 6 to 10 feet in length, they serve as a perfect focal point for family gatherings and entertaining.

When it comes to mixing patterns, a vintage farmhouse dining table shines. You can enhance its rustic appeal with mismatched chairs, allowing for playful pattern mixing through textiles and finishes. Opt for soft, muted colors or natural stains that seamlessly blend with your existing country decor styles. This approach not only highlights the table's character but also creates an inviting atmosphere that encourages conversation.

Incorporating various materials and textures, like woven seat cushions or patterned table runners, adds depth to your dining area. By thoughtfully combining these elements, your vintage farmhouse dining table will transform into a centerpiece that reflects your personal style while embracing the charm of country decor.

Antique Wooden Sideboard

An antique wooden sideboard adds both functionality and charm to your country decor, offering storage and display options for your favorite dishes and decorative items. Made from durable hardwoods like oak, pine, or mahogany, these sideboards often showcase intricate carvings or unique finishes that enhance the rustic look of your space.

Typically ranging from 36 to 50 inches in height and 40 to 80 inches wide, an antique wooden sideboard fits beautifully in various dining room sizes. Many include drawers, shelves, or glass-front cabinets, providing versatile organization for linens and other essentials.

To create a cohesive and inviting atmosphere, consider how you'll incorporate a pattern mix with your sideboard. Pair it with floral table runners or gingham accents to harmonize different textures and colors. This thoughtful integration can make your sideboard a focal point, elevating your entire room's aesthetic.

Incorporating an antique wooden sideboard not only enhances your decor but also serves as a practical piece that reflects your style. With the right pattern mix, you'll achieve a warm, welcoming ambiance that embodies the essence of country living.

Reclaimed Barn Wood Planks

Reclaimed barn wood planks add unique character and a rich history to your flooring choices, making them a perfect fit for country decor. These planks are sourced from old barns and silos, so their natural variations in colors, grain, and texture create an inviting rustic aesthetic.

When you install reclaimed wood, you'll notice how its inherent patterns can complement your existing decor while adding depth to the overall design.

You have the option to choose between solid or engineered flooring, providing flexibility based on your preferences and the specific requirements of your space. Not only do these planks enhance the beauty of your home, but they're also eco-friendly and sustainable. By opting for reclaimed wood, you're reducing the demand for new lumber, making a responsible choice for the environment.

To keep your reclaimed barn wood flooring looking its best, regular cleaning and periodic sealing are essential. These maintenance practices preserve the durability and charm of the wood, ensuring it continues to enhance your country-themed decor for years to come.

Embrace the warmth and history that reclaimed barn wood planks bring to your home!

Natural Stone Tile Flooring

Natural stone tile flooring, like slate and travertine, brings an organic touch to your country decor, enhancing the rustic charm established by reclaimed barn wood planks. The unique textures and colors of natural stone tiles create a stunning backdrop for your home, allowing you to showcase your personalized style. Each piece of stone is distinct, ensuring that no two floors are alike, which adds character to your space.

Durability is another significant advantage of natural stone tile flooring. It withstands heavy foot traffic, making it perfect for busy family areas. Plus, it's low maintenance, which means you'll spend less time worrying about upkeep and more time enjoying your beautiful home.

You can also get creative with installation patterns. Whether you choose a herringbone design or a staggered layout, you can emphasize the organic pattern of the stone, adding visual interest without straying from the cohesive country feel.

Impact of Border Control Policies

border control policy effects

Literary devices in immigration narratives vividly showcase the impact of border control policies on the lives of immigrants and their communities. The stringent enforcement of these policies has led to heightened militarization and surveillance along the U.S.-Mexico border, increasing risks for those attempting to cross and resulting in tragic outcomes.

Families seeking asylum or a better life often endure separation and detention due to these measures, causing emotional distress and trauma. Additionally, the implementation of border control policies has created significant barriers, making the journey for immigrants more perilous as they navigate legal and physical obstacles.

These policies have sparked debates on immigration reform, centering on security, humanitarian concerns, and the rights of immigrants. The consequences of these policies extend beyond mere regulations, impacting the lives and well-being of individuals striving for a better future.
